SpaceX, Blue Origin, Stoke Space and Starcloud pulled out of Macron’s Paris space summit after White House pressure, though several are expected back in the city days later for World Space Business Week. Organisers describe the event as behind schedule and unclear in purpose, while Washington lobbies against the EU Space Act. Four American space […] This story continues at The Next Web
